Human: End Blade, Arrowhead Tip (Star Trek Communicator Device), Hot Springs Village, Port Moller, Alaska CAT# 77-47-U53 Okada Excavations HHU, Level 3. Hot Springs 2B. 500-800 CE. The massive village of Hot Springs sits dramatically on the shore of Port Moller, situated on the Alaska Peninsula side of the southern Bering Sea. Several distinct teams have excavated this site over the past century. Major occupations date back to 2000 BCE-1000 BCE and from 100 CE to 800 CE. The artifacts unearthed at Hot Springs Village are a direct result of research conducted under grants NSF 0137756, NSF 1204020, NSF 1139266, and NSF 1321411. H. Maschner serves as Principal Investigator. Original digitizing efforts took place at the IVL at Idaho State University. Subsequent processing was completed by Global Digital Heritage.
